Giants Causeway

Giants Causeway is one of the most famous and popular tourist attractions in Ireland.  It was caused by a volcanic eruption 65 million years ago and is a cluster of around 40,000 basalt columns all joined together!  I’ve seen so many pictures of this natural formation, but it would be amazing to see it in person!  There’s nothing quite like seeing and experiencing nature in person.

Connemara National Park

Connemara National Park has amazing reviews on TripAdvisor and looks so stunning.  I love exploring mountainous trails and this national park looks like it has plenty.  It looks to be very green with mountain views and gorgeous lakes.  Lots of people recommend climbing to the top of Diamond Hill where there are different trails to suit all abilities.

Wicklow Mountains

Wicklow Mountains National Park is another rugged mountainous landscape with lakes, waterfalls and more to see and explore.  It looks like a great place for hiking, but there are also three roads for scenic drives through Wicklow Mountains which sound great for a road trip idea in Ireland.
